Unintended, malicious and evil applications of augmented reality

Abstract

Most new products begin life with a marketing pitch that extols the product's cultures. A Similarly optimistic property holds in user-centered design, where most books and classes take for granted that interface designers are out to help the user. Users themselves are assumed to be good natured, upstanding citizens somewhere out of the Leave it to Beaver universe.
